Department heads should note that Harwick Group has agreed in principle to sell its Coastal Logistics unit to Brellan Holdings. The unit's warehousing operations in Tarnmouth will transfer intact, with staff consultations beginning next month. Proceeds will retire the revolving facility and fund the Orivale automation programme. Finance has completed due diligence support; Legal is finalising warranties. No external announcement until signing. The confidential note below sets out the plan for redeploying the remaining proceeds.

internal memo for kawip-hadug: Headcount on the Wenwyn team goes from 7 to 140 by the end of January. Gross margin on Wenwyn came in at 20 percent against a plan of 15 percent.

Subject: Slimmer base images for Pondhollow services

Team, this week's release trims our container images by roughly 40%. We moved to a distroless base, dropped debug tooling, and split the migration layer out. Please verify your local pulls complete faster and that health checks still pass. For reference, the slimmed image was produced from the build identified below.

build token for kagaf-hahof: htk14_9d3d4d26d7d8de

### Turnstile Counter Review — Halden Arena

We walked through the GateTally counter logic for the east concourse turnstiles. Counts are buffered locally during network loss and reconciled hourly, which the reviewer flagged as a tampering window. A signed-log fix is scheduled before the season opener. Questions about the reconciliation design should go to the engineer accountable, named below.

named custodian: Brivan Eliath Quenox Frador

Subject: Proposed Closure — Ellersby Office

Board members,

We recommend closing the Ellersby satellite office at lease end. Headcount of six transfers to the Varnholt hub; two roles become remote. Estimated annual savings are material relative to the site's output. A consultation timeline is attached. The confidential outline of the consolidation plan appears immediately below.

internal memo for kaguf-yajog: Headcount on the Druath team goes from 30 to 70 by the end of November. Gross margin on Druath came in at 56 percent against a plan of 28 percent.